"But they seem so high-functioning…"
That one phrase has left countless Autistic individuals without the support they desperately need.
Meanwhile, those labeled “low-functioning” often have their autonomy dismissed before they even get a chance to show what they’re capable of.
These labels? They don’t help—they harm.
They misrepresent abilities, erase real struggles, and hold back progress in education, therapy, and everyday life.
On this episode of Making the Shift, we’re talking why it's time to ditch the functioning labels and shift to a more accurate, affirming way of talking about autism.
We're diving into:
✔️ The biggest misconceptions about "high-" and "low-functioning" labels.
✔️ How these labels affect everything from accommodations to autonomy.
✔️ Why autism is a spiky profile, not a straight line from mild to severe.
✔️ A more affirming way to describe support needs—without limiting anyone’s potential.
✔️ And more!
